Would you like your collection posted? Follow these instructions.

SCAN YOUR OWN PICTURES: NO FEES APPLY

If you have your own digital scanner, you may submit your own photo images. Scans greater than 150 dpi are preferred and saved onto a CD. JPG images preferred. No png, gifs or PDFs please. Please print and complete the page with the Instructions for submitting your CD images to the Association. Adhere to requirements and directions please. Please include descriptions and identify individuals if you can. By submitting your pictures to the Red Warriors Association you are permitting and allowing us to post your photos on the World Wide Web.

LET US SCAN YOUR PICTURES: FEES APPLY

Actual photographs, color and black and white negatives, and 35mm slides may be sent, but fees apply for scanning to a digital format for archiving. Other restoration services are available. Fading pictures can be restored. Please print and complete the PDF Photograph Form and Instructions before sending any materials. Unsolicited items and pictures which are unidentified will not be accepted. Original photos will be returned to you. Our purpose is to identify our fellow Red Warriors in all pictures. Please take the time to identify and number your pictures. By submitting your pictures to the Red Warriors Association you are permitting and allowing us to post your photos on the World Wide Web.
